1956 C.F. Martin D-21 – Natural
We present an original 1956 C.F. Martin D-21 in its original Natural finish. Made in Nazareth, Pennsylvania.
This beautiful 1956 Martin D-21 is truly exceptional. It marks the first year of production for this iconic model. The guitar delivers fantastic tone and playability throughout. It features stunning rosewood back and sides with high-quality quarter-sawn grain. The spruce top reveals signs of extensive play and showcases classic Style 21 appointments. The comfortable, soft V-shaped mahogany neck with pearl dot position markers plays effortlessly. Notable details include a tortoise shell pickguard, tortoise body binding, and black/white trim and rosette.
Overall, the guitar is in excellent condition for its age, with typical cosmetic wear such as nicks, dings, buckle rash on the back, and other signs of honest play. There are no crack repairs on the sides or back — only a single, professionally repaired hairline crack on the top. This vintage C.F. Martin has clearly been well-loved and played, and remains a stunning example of a classic flat top acoustic guitar.
Comes complete with its original and rare hardshell case. All latches and the handle are in perfect working order.
Repairs done by a professional Luthier:
- New saddle.
- Original bridge has been reglued.
- Neck reset.
- New bridge pins.
- Strap button is installed on the neck heel.
- Tiny hairline crack repair on the top that has been sealed.
- The original tuners are replaced to newer reproduction.
